Understanding Osteoporosis: Causes, Symptoms, and Diagnosis

Osteoporosis is a condition which weakens bones, making here them fragile and likely to fractures. Various factors can contribute to osteoporosis, like age, sex, genetics, and lifestyle choices.

Symptoms of osteoporosis are often subtle in the early stages. ,As well as individuals may have back pain, loss of height, or forward curvature. A diagnosis of osteoporosis is usually made through a bone density test, which measures the strength of your bones.

It's crucial to see a healthcare professional if you have any concerns about osteoporosis. They can help you understand your risk factors, recommend preventive measures, and develop a treatment plan should needed.

Treating Osteoporosis with Medication: Key Insights

Osteoporosis, a condition characterized by weakened bones and increased fracture risk, necessitates effective pharmacological management. Various medications are available to slow bone loss and Promote bone density, thus reducing the chance of fractures. Osteoporosis drugs, such as bisphosphonates, denosumab, and hormone therapy, operate by blocking bone breakdown by osteoclasts. Conversely, anabolic agents like teriparatide stimulate bone formation by osteoblasts, promoting new bone growth. Choosing the appropriate medication depends on individual factors such as age, fracture risk, and medical history. Discussing a healthcare professional is essential to determine the best treatment plan for managing osteoporosis effectively.

  • Risedronate are commonly prescribed medications that inhibit bone resorption by osteoclasts, reducing bone loss and increasing bone density.
  • Denosumab, a monoclonal antibody, targets RANKL, a protein involved in osteoclast activation, effectively suppressing bone breakdown.
  • Hormone therapy can be beneficial in postmenopausal women by restoring estrogen levels, which help maintain bone density.

Living with Osteoporosis: Strategies for Prevention and Management

Osteoporosis, a condition characterized by weakened bones, can pose a significant threat to overall fitness. While there's no remedy for osteoporosis, adopting proactive measures can help reduce its impact. Timely intervention is crucial, focusing on habitual changes and medical support. A nutritious diet rich in calcium is paramount, alongside frequent weight-bearing exercises.

  • Engage with your doctor regularly for screening and to discuss suitable treatment options.
  • Minimize alcohol consumption and avoid smoking, as these practices can worsen bone strength.
  • Maintain a healthy weight, as both obesity and underweight can negatively affect bone status.
